Job Summary

We are seeking a skilled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to join our team at CPG Stevensville Clinic. As a key member of our healthcare delivery system, you will play a vital role in assisting physicians with patient care.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Patient Care: Greet and escort patients to exam rooms, take vitals, height, weight, and histories, and update medication and develop patient education materials.
  • Preparation and Administration: Prepare patient equipment and medication prescriptions for physicians, phone in prescription refills with physician approval, and administer vaccinations.
  • Charting and Communication: Chart patient information, prepare informed consent forms, and call physician orders to other healthcare providers.
  • Supply Management: Order clinical supplies and maintain exam rooms.
Additional Responsibilities:
  • Filling in for the scribe function and occasionally checking in patients and answering phone calls.
Requirements:
  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ing and licensed in the State of Montana as a Licensed Practical Nurse.
  • Current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ification.
  • Healthcare provider BLS certification within three months of hire.
  • Verbal and written communication skills, typing, and computer skills (Microsoft Office).
